About 20 years ago we had my father's cremains scattered in the Gulf off of Clearwater Beach. First, realize that scattering your loved one's cremains is an extremely powerful emotional experience. If you had any doubts that your loved one is gone, watching his remains going floating away will remove them. It's not something you'd want to do in the middle of a theme park. I'm a 53 year old man, am not given to emotional displays, but I still had to get up and walk away from the computer in the middle of composing this message, the memory was so strong.

Second, at the time it was Florida law that cremains had to be scattered by a licensed funeral director. I would assume that is still the case. So, if you got caught, not only would Disney throw you out, and may very well bill you for the cleanup, you'd also get a visit from the sheriff.

Scattering of cremains is a private solemn moment, I couldn't imagine doing it at a theme park, not to mention how disrespectful it would be to the other park patrons.

FYI, just in case anyone decides that they want to try to do it discreetly anyway; if you have never had occasion to scatter ashes before, be aware that it is virtually impossible to discreetly "scatter" cremains. The slightest breeze will cause the dust to swirl around you, and it can often blow back all over the place if you try to do it from any kind of vehicle or structure.

I found that out the hard way, while attempting to honor my brother's wishes about how he wanted his ashes scattered. It was winter, and quite frankly, at least about 10% of his remains ended up on me and my family members instead of on the land.
